Cambrils reviews

The Jackson Family | June 2009

Great campsite and lots to do in the nearby areas. We visited nou camp (Barcelona's football ground), porta ventura and also did a days shopping in las ramblas as well as visiting the beautiful gaudi cathedral! When we weren’t off exploring, we spent much of our time around the pool area (which has two huge elephants and a waterslide!), there’s a bar next to one of the pools, so you get to relax while the kids are off splashing about and making new friends. The campsite also had lots of sports you and your kids can do, so there was plenty to keep my whole family busy! The campsite also has a restaurant, bar takeaway and shop, which we thought were all reasonably priced compared to some campsites we have stayed at in Spain. I wouldn’t hesitate in recommending this campsite to anyone, as we had a amazing holiday and we will definitely be going back again.

The Tinsley Family | May 2009

Cambrils is a large campsite in salou, which is not too far from Barcelona, so there are plenty of things to do/see. The campsite itself was nothing special, it has the usual swimming pools, restaurant, bar, shop, sports facilities etc. I wouldn't say that the park is run down, but I equally wouldn't say that it has been well cared for. It's a good place to stay if you want to explore the surrounding areas, but if you are the type of family who spend all of your holiday at the campsite, then you would be better off staying somewhere else.
